We are seeking a skilled and dedicated Multi-Site General Manager to join our team. The General Manager is responsible for all aspects of the operations at the Resort regarding day-to-day staff management and guests. Our General Manager is an ambassador for Capital Vacations providing leadership and strategic planning to all departments in support of our service culture that emphasizes optimizing operations and guest satisfaction. The General Manager works very closely with our Owners and Board Members.

Overseeing the operations functions of the Resort
Processing and submitting payroll to Human Resources
Holding regular briefings and meetings with all heads of departments. Oversees and manages all departments and works closely with department heads daily. Is accountable for the responsibilities of department heads and takes ownership of all guest complaints. Steps in and performs any task or covers any department as necessary including front desk housekeeping maintenance etc.
Ensuring full compliance with Resort Operating controls SOPs policies procedures and service standards
Leads all key property issues including capital projects customer service and refurbishment
Handles complaints and oversees service recovery procedures
Is responsible for the preparation presentation and subsequent achievement of the resorts Annual Operating Budget Marketing and Sales Plan and Capital Budget. Manages ongoing profitability of the Resort ensuring revenue and guest satisfaction targets are met and exceeded. Delivers resort budget goals and sets other short- and long-term strategic goals for the property. Develops improvement actions and carries out cost savings
Ensures all decisions made are in the best interest of the Resort and Management
Maintains a strong understanding of P&L statements and the ability to react with impactful strategies
Ensures the monthly financial outlooks for the Resort are on target and accurate. Prepares monthly financial reporting for the Owners and Board Members. Draws up plans and budget (revenue costs etc.) for Owners
Provides effective leadership to all Resort Team Members
Responds to audits to ensure continual achieved improvement
Is responsible for safeguarding the quality of operations (both internal & external audits). Is responsible for legalization Occupational Health & SafetyAct fire regulations and other legal requirements
